as you can see above, it controls what aspects of windows starts up, like win.ini, etc. also shows you what is written in the system.ini, win.ini, and boot.ini files. It also shows what services start up on setup, and also what programs are set to run at windows startup. edit: agreed, Equivelant.. I used to use this for 2000, but forgot about it..
